KTM EXC description

I have an three KTM 250 EXC that I would like sale or trade for a street bike. The bike is very reliable and in attractive condition for a ten year old bike, has beautiful black Excel rims and aftermarket expansion chamber. The EXC's are geared for trail riding with a weighted flywheel providing more lower end torque than other two stroke dirt bikes. This bike does not disappoint! Bike comes with extra:- two front fenders, 1 still in the bag - back tire, basically new- front rotorI am interested in trading for a street bike like a Vstrom, Bandit, FZ6, GSX, Ninja or SV. 2014 KTM 1290 Super Duke R Revealed

Tue, 01 Oct 2013

Almost a year after it was revealed in prototype form, KTM has released final specifications and photographs of the all-new 1290 Super Duke R production model. Until now, KTM had been coy about the specs for its large-displacement naked bike, but we can now see what makes the Austrian manufacturer nickname the new Super Duke R as “the Beast”. In typical KTM style, the 1290 in the bike’s name provides only a ballpark estimate of the actual engine displacement.

Helen Kurt Caselli Send-Off Attracts Thousands

Fri, 20 Dec 2013

In a touching tribute to Kurt Caselli, one of America’s brightest off-road racing stars, who tragically lost his life in a crash while competing in the Baja 1000, a gathering of over 2000 people descended upon Glen Helen Raceway to pay their final respects in a rolling tribute. The line of cars stretching back to the nearby freeway was a fitting reminder of just how many lives Caselli touched and how important a figure he was to many. Caselli’s KTM crew and teammates were just some of the many who came to pay their respects and take a ride-out in Kurt’s honor with his mom Nancy and fiancée Sarah at the head of the vast pack of motorcyclists. Motocrossers like Dean Wilson, Blake Baggett, Cole Seely and then other luminaries like AMA Superbike racer Chris Fillmore and off-roaders like Destry Abbott were part of the group.
